BV52 XOL is a 2002 Mcc Smart Pulse Softip(rhd) S-a in Black with a 599c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 28 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60.7%.
Across all 2002 Mcc Smart Pulse Softip(rhd) S-a models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.1% with a typical mileage of 52,840 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mcc Smart Pulse Softip(rhd) S-a fails its MOT is stop lamp not working, accounting for 223 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BV52 XOL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mcc Smart Pulse Softip(rhd) S-a typ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 24 years old, this Mcc Smart Pulse Softip(rhd) S-a is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
